Activity on the Asia-Pacific calendar will continue to gather momentum in the week ahead, with several updates on Australia's economic health, including its manufacturing and employment situations.
Monday, February 18
- Reserve Bank of Australia's ((RBA)) Meeting Minutes
The RBA at its monetary policy meeting earlier in February elected to keep the cash rate at 1.5%, where it's been since August 2016.
RBA Governor Philip Lowe noted that Australia's economy is set to grow by around 3% in 2019 and by a little less than that figure in 2020, mainly due to slower growth in exports
